FAX Bag Nanyn
Thursday 20th October 2011

Story in brief:
Goalkicking centre arrives at the Shay Halifax Rugby League have made another big coup, capturing free scoring centre, Mick Nanyn on a 1 year deal, with an option for a second year. The goal kicking three quarter joins a strong line including the likes of Lee Paterson, Steve Tyrer, Paul White, Rob Worrincy and Wayne Reittie, and will also be facing a tough task in becoming the Club’s number one kicker.

Halifax now have Nanyn, Tyrer, Handforth, and Paterson, all four appearing in the top 5 Championship Goalkickers in recent seasons. Karl Harrison will be spoilt for choice once pre season begins, having an abundance of reliable marksmen. Mick becomes the 24th player to sign on for 2012, and at 29 years of age, automatically becomes one of the Club’s most experienced members.

“As soon as Mick became available we wanted to look at him and see if a deal could be done. He had interest from quite a few clubs but he sees what we’re building here and is keen to remain at the top of the table. He’s been involved in some very good sides and always put points on the board. We should be a tremendous threat for us going into the new season.” Said Ian Croad, Club Director.

Halifax now enter 2012 with the potential of pairing Steve Tyrer and Mick Nanyn with Paul White and Rob Worrincy, the four of them registering nearly 100 tries between them in 2011. FAX now have 2 of the top three point scorers of 2011, and 3 of the top 5 try scorers, hinting that the Club be in for an exciting few seasons.

“As a team we’ve always scored tries and there should be no reason that doesn’t continue. Karl’s main aim was to bring balance and I think everyone’s very excited about what he’s built. There’s still a few weeks until players return to training, but signs are good for a very strong off-season.
